Summary of what’s new in Dynamics 365 Remote Assist

When a month is used in the Date column, the feature will be delivered sometime within that month. The delivery date can be any day within that month, not just on the first day of the month.
Feature | Release type | Date |
---|---|---|
Integration with Dynamics 365 for Field Service | General Availability | October 1, 2018 |
Insert a PDF file | General Availability | October 1, 2018 |
Take a snapshot to capture annotations | General Availability | October 1, 2018 |
Text chat | General Availability | October 1, 2018 |
Add directional arrows | General Availability | October 1, 2018 |
Audio adjusts automatically during a Remote Assist call | General Availability | October 1, 2018 |
Use voice commands | General Availability | October 1, 2018 |
Launch Remote Assist from another app using protocol activation | General Availability | October 1, 2018 |
Screen sharing | General Availability | December 10, 2018 |
Ghost arrows show where arrows will be placed | General Availability | January 28, 2019 |
Narrator announces incoming calls | General Availability | January 28, 2019 |
Additional voice and gaze commands | General Availability | January 28, 2019 |
90-day free trial | General Availability | March 11, 2019 |
Improved Dynamics 365 for Field Service integration | General Availability | March 11, 2019 |
